Explanation: Sensation could be defined as an individual's mental ability to notice or detect an external or internal stimulation of the sensory organs. The basic sensory organs which includes the skin, nose, eyes, ear and tongue receives external stimulus, which is then transduced or converted into electrical impulses which travels to the appropriate part of the brain for decoding.

In late adulthood, when people are at the age of 65 or older they start to reminisce about their lives and come into terms with what they have accomplished or have failed to accomplish. If they are satisfied with what they have accomplished they will find integrity but if they regret and can't make peace with their failure they would experience despair.
They question themselves to whether have they lived meaningfully
When the person look back at their journey of life they may either establish a sense of satisfaction or they may regret all they did or did not do and despair over those missed opportunities.

Euthanasia is also another word for mercy killing. It is a death that is easy or death that is without pain. Euthanasia describes the act of putting an end to a person's life. This could be done at the request of the person who might be suffering from an incurable ailments or one who is in Great pains. It can be carried out through the use of lethal injections which would shut down the heart and brain in a few minutes.
